Embedded in the firm's wider UK network, Slater and Gordon's clinical negligence department provides assistance with a broad spectrum of matters, including fatal claims, psychiatric injury and delayed diagnoses of cancer. Described as ‘a force to be reckoned with,’ Sarah McWhirter oversees the team and has a broad practice that covers obstetric, birth and surgical injury claims. Associate Fiona Fowle, who handles brain injury, spinal injury and fatal claims, and solicitor Claire Paterson, who deals with a wide range of complex medical negligence cases, are other key contacts.
